From the SKILL.md

# Rewrite plan Spec §20.3 / §21.3.2: scenario 4 (design → deliverable production code) requires a contract-shaped rewrite plan before the agent starts editing files. The plan is **the audit trail** every subsequent stage references; without it the patch path slides into "refactor everything that looks wrong" and the build breaks in unreviewable ways. ## Inputs - `code/index.json` from `code-import`. - `token-map/*.json` from `token-map`. - The active design system DESIGN.md (already in prompt). - The user's tune intent (typically a short brief). ## Output ```text project-cwd/ └── plan/ ├── plan.md # human-readable narrative ├── ownership.json # { file: '...', layer: 'leaf' | 'shared' | 'route' | 'shell' } ├── steps.json # ordered { id, files[], rationale, risk: 'low' | 'medium' | 'high' }[] └── meta.json # { generatedAt, atomDigest, tokenMapDigest } ``` `steps.json` is the input `patch-edit` reads one entry per iteration. `ownership.json` is the source of truth for "which files belong to a single component vs. shared infrastructure"; `patch-edit` refuses to touch a `shell`-tier file unless the matching step has `risk: 'high'` and the user explicitly confirmed. ## Convergence The at
